Tree-Based Public Key Encryption with Conjunctive Keyword Search
Searchable public key encryption supporting conjunctive keyword search is an important technique in today’s cloud environment. Nowadays, previous schemes usually take advantage of forward index structure, which leads to a linear search complexity. In order to obtain better search efficiency, in this...
Guardado en:
Autores principales: | , , |
---|---|
Formato: | article |
Lenguaje: | EN |
Publicado: |
Hindawi-Wiley
2021
|
Materias: | |
Acceso en línea: | https://doaj.org/article/f21470d94a624117a930959009ec2a3e |
Etiquetas: |
Agregar Etiqueta
Sin Etiquetas, Sea el primero en etiquetar este registro!
|
id |
oai:doaj.org-article:f21470d94a624117a930959009ec2a3e |
---|---|
record_format |
dspace |
spelling |
oai:doaj.org-article:f21470d94a624117a930959009ec2a3e2021-11-15T01:19:03ZTree-Based Public Key Encryption with Conjunctive Keyword Search1939-012210.1155/2021/7034944https://doaj.org/article/f21470d94a624117a930959009ec2a3e2021-01-01T00:00:00Zhttp://dx.doi.org/10.1155/2021/7034944https://doaj.org/toc/1939-0122Searchable public key encryption supporting conjunctive keyword search is an important technique in today’s cloud environment. Nowadays, previous schemes usually take advantage of forward index structure, which leads to a linear search complexity. In order to obtain better search efficiency, in this paper, we utilize a tree index structure instead of forward index to realize such schemes. To achieve the goal, we first give a set of keyword conversion methods that can convert the index and query keywords into a group of vectors and then present a novel algorithm for building index tree based on these vectors. Finally, by combining an efficient predicate encryption scheme to encrypt the index tree, a tree-based public key encryption with conjunctive keyword search scheme is proposed. The proposed scheme is proven to be secure against chosen plaintext attacks and achieves a sublinear search complexity. Moreover, both theoretical analysis and experimental result show that the proposed scheme is efficient and feasible for practical applications.Yu ZhangLei YouYin LiHindawi-WileyarticleTechnology (General)T1-995Science (General)Q1-390ENSecurity and Communication Networks, Vol 2021 (2021) |
institution |
DOAJ |
collection |
DOAJ |
language |
EN |
topic |
Technology (General) T1-995 Science (General) Q1-390 |
spellingShingle |
Technology (General) T1-995 Science (General) Q1-390 Yu Zhang Lei You Yin Li Tree-Based Public Key Encryption with Conjunctive Keyword Search |
description |
Searchable public key encryption supporting conjunctive keyword search is an important technique in today’s cloud environment. Nowadays, previous schemes usually take advantage of forward index structure, which leads to a linear search complexity. In order to obtain better search efficiency, in this paper, we utilize a tree index structure instead of forward index to realize such schemes. To achieve the goal, we first give a set of keyword conversion methods that can convert the index and query keywords into a group of vectors and then present a novel algorithm for building index tree based on these vectors. Finally, by combining an efficient predicate encryption scheme to encrypt the index tree, a tree-based public key encryption with conjunctive keyword search scheme is proposed. The proposed scheme is proven to be secure against chosen plaintext attacks and achieves a sublinear search complexity. Moreover, both theoretical analysis and experimental result show that the proposed scheme is efficient and feasible for practical applications. |
format |
article |
author |
Yu Zhang Lei You Yin Li |
author_facet |
Yu Zhang Lei You Yin Li |
author_sort |
Yu Zhang |
title |
Tree-Based Public Key Encryption with Conjunctive Keyword Search |
title_short |
Tree-Based Public Key Encryption with Conjunctive Keyword Search |
title_full |
Tree-Based Public Key Encryption with Conjunctive Keyword Search |
title_fullStr |
Tree-Based Public Key Encryption with Conjunctive Keyword Search |
title_full_unstemmed |
Tree-Based Public Key Encryption with Conjunctive Keyword Search |
title_sort |
tree-based public key encryption with conjunctive keyword search |
publisher |
Hindawi-Wiley |
publishDate |
2021 |
url |
https://doaj.org/article/f21470d94a624117a930959009ec2a3e |
work_keys_str_mv |
AT yuzhang treebasedpublickeyencryptionwithconjunctivekeywordsearch AT leiyou treebasedpublickeyencryptionwithconjunctivekeywordsearch AT yinli treebasedpublickeyencryptionwithconjunctivekeywordsearch |
_version_ |
1718429019363344384 |